手机软件测试实习报告
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
河北工业大学
毕业实习报告
姓名: XXX 学号: ******
专业班级: XXXXXXXXXX
实习单位:北京北阳电子技术有限公司
实习时间:2011年2月14日—2O11年4月1日
指导教师: XXX
一.实习目的:理论联系实际,通过把所学软件测试知识与实际操作相结合,熟练软件测试操作流程,根据实际操作总结学习中的错误认识,拓
展思维方法并学习实际业务流程中的相关技巧和同事之间的相处
问题。
二.实习时间:2011年2月23日——2011年4月1日
三.实习地点:北京海淀区上地三街中黎科技园1号楼5层
四.实习单位:北京北阳电子技术有限公司
五.实习内容:
1.公司背景
北京北阳电子技术有限公司成立于1997年,地处属国家级高科技园区的北京上地信息产业基地,系高新技术企业,已先后经北京市科委评审被认定为软件企业和集成电路企业。
作为台湾凌阳科技股份有限公司在中国大陆的合作伙伴,北阳电子带着“科技落实生活”的愿景,致力于微控制器、数字信号处理器(DSP)应用与开发,以及系统工具软件、消费类娱乐产品和家庭网络产品的开发和研制,并实现通讯及多媒体技术的商品化,使人们能够享受到高科技带来的舒适、便利与欢乐,从而提升人们的生活品质。
2.平台构建
围绕经营理念的实现,北阳电子在主营高新技术原动力驱动下,打造出与之相适应的系列平台,诸如技术研发、知识管理、品质管理、智权产出、技术推广以及企业管理等平台。
在这些平台上伴随着资源的有效管理和知识、智慧的混合运作,高速、高效的载着源源不断的富创意、优品质的技术研发和推广的成果,为给客户一流的产品开发方案和满意的技术服务提供了保证,亦为北阳无可替代的优势打下坚实的基础。
3.团队建设
多年来北阳公司一直致力于团队的基础建设,从创业伊始的三、五十人发展至今已建成一个具有相当规模的研发、品保、知识产权、技术推广以及技资管理等团队的正规专业型企业。每一团队,都在公司有着举足轻重的位置,其作用一环扣一环,缺一不可。团队之间的通畅协作,不仅增强团队本身战斗力,而且亦增
强了公司的整体运作能力。
公司为员工提供了施展才华的舞台,员工为公司效力、为团队拼搏的出发点源于实现自身价值。个人的才智和能力亦在集体环境的熏陶下得到了充分发挥和升华。
4.技术与产品
北阳电子掌握声音和图像处理技术、微控制器设计、以及IC电路设计和应用软体设计技术,自力研发。从各种高低阶微处理器核心,DSP设计等SOC平台之开发工具,如编译器、集成开发环境、操作系统等,到演算法研究、IC设计等核心技术,发展出多样化的产品线。
主要开发项目为:IC应用软件开发、IC电路设计、IC版图设计、应用工具开发、IC系统开发、图像及语音数字信号处理、语音识别应用程序开发、智能化家电信息应用开发。
公司目前主要产品线包括:单片机、液晶显示控制器、多媒体、语音芯片、及各式客户委托设计芯片,应用于电子字典、MP4及MP3、计算器外围、智能家电控制器、VCD、DVD、数码相机、播放机、来电显示器、语音复读机…,在日常生活中无所不在。
5.我所在的职位
职位名称:软件测试工程师
职位描述:
①负责产品测试工作,根据软件需求大减测试环境和计划
②负责软件不同功能模块的系统测试
③认真执行测试用例
④负责协助组长进行测试统计工作
⑤负责自己测试出的bug的提交工作
⑥负责填写自己测试模块的测试小结
⑦负责协助开发人员解决bug
⑧对解决的bug后的回归测试
⑨负责填写自己测试模块的回归测试小结
⑩每周提交工作总结报告
6.具体工作内容
①每天根据软件测试需求,连接好正确的硬件设备,搭配好正确的端口,为测试
软件选择不同文件参数和版本号,最终搭建好测试环境
②每天对组长分配给自己的手机模块进行测试,认真执行分配的手机模块的每一
条测试用例,在执行英文测试用例时要反复阅读Spec文档,保证测试用例的正确执行
③在测试过程中,手机出现问题时,根据是手机硬件还是软件出现的问题,如果
是软件问题,需要抓取bug,首先抓取consolelog和genielog,然后抓取HSLlog,查看问题属于Manjor、minor、crash、再选择不同的工具抓取其他log,最后还要用相机拍取图片
④将抓取的log按照命名规则进行统一的命名,然后对log进行打包处理,处理
完毕后向本地服务器提交bug,由组长对bug进行审查
⑤组长审查完毕,如果bug的提取有问题,则feedback给reporter重新修改,
如果组长审查完毕后bug没有问题,将bug向外网服务器上进行提交,并在固定的服务器上上传log
⑥当log提交后,开发人员会在外网服务器上看到自己提取的bug,我们负责解
决他们在解决bug过程中产生的疑问,并重新构建执行测试用例的测试环境,而且进行复现测试。
⑦对开发人员解决的bug,要重新进行回归测试,并对软件的其他一些功能进行
检查,执行更多的测试用例,尽量发现软件中一些其他的由于开发人员的代码变动而引起的其他错误,来保证软件的质量
⑧填写回归测试的测试小结,总结自己测试的case数量、时间以及自己测试过
程中产生的bug数量等内容
⑨每天和每周要提交自己的工作总结包括每天的收获和遇到的困难
5.工作中发现的问题
①由于实习的时间不太长,培训灌输了大量的知识,在测试过程中遇到问题时常
常不知正确的操作流程,不能正确的抓取log或少抓log的现象时有发生,对手机进行测试时测试的环境把握很关键,常常由于对case没有很好的理解导致没有预置正确的测试环境而不能验证bug或复现bug。
②在实习的这段时间中,对测试工具的使用不是很熟练,而且还有很多工具没有
用到和操作,因此在遇到问题时常常有些log常常因为工具的不会使用而被漏